Europe faces an emerging economic headwind from accelerating climate volatility, with the continent warming faster than global averages and triggering cascading operational disruptions. This regional thermal stress translates into measurable GDP drag through energy constraints, agricultural yield compression, and infrastructure strain—dynamics that historically correlate inversely with broad equity market performance during cyclical downturns.

The climate shock differentially impacts utilities and industrial infrastructure operators across the EU, where aging power grids and water systems face simultaneous demand spikes and supply constraints. Insurance-linked securities like ALIZY and ALIZF face heightened loss frequency modeling, as catastrophic weather events become baseline rather than tail-risk scenarios. Insurers and reinsurers embedded in European exposure carry elevated claims reserves.

Macro implications include potential ECB policy divergence—thermal stress may constrain growth forecasts while inflation from supply-side shocks complicates rate-path normalization. Cross-sector profit margin compression emerges as input costs (energy, water) rise while pricing power remains constrained in competitive EU markets.

Sector implication: Defensive plays and renewable energy infrastructure may benefit from policy response, while cyclical industrials face headwind reassessment. Financial services pricing increasingly incorporates climate-adjusted risk premiums.
